Optimization for Decision Making: Linear and Quadratic Models by Katta G. Murty
English | PDF | 2010 | 502 Pages | ISBN : 1441912908 | 4.5 MB

Optimization for Decision Making: Linear and Quadratic Models is a first-year graduate level text that illustrates how to formulate real world problems using linear and quadratic models; how to use efficient algorithms – both old and new – for solving these models; and how to draw useful conclusions and derive useful planning information from the output of these algorithms. While almost all the best known books on LP are essentially mathematics books with only very simple modeling examples, this book emphasizes the intelligent modeling of real world problems, and the author presents several illustrative examples and includes many exercises from a variety of application areas.

Developments in Global Optimization by Immanuel M. Bomze, Tibor Csendes, Reiner Horst, Panos M. Pardalos
English | PDF | 1997 | 350 Pages | ISBN : 0792343514 | 28.1 MB

In recent years global optimization has found applications in many interesting areas of science and technology including molecular biology, chemical equilibrium problems, medical imaging and networks. The collection of papers in this book indicates the diverse applicability of global optimization. Furthermore, various algorithmic, theoretical developments and computational studies are presented.
Audience: All researchers and students working in mathematical programming.
